none
System.ArgumentNullException: 值不能为空。参数名: type RRS feed

  • 问题

  • 我在xp机子下的vs2005做的程序,发布到本机上用IIS访问,实验没有错误。

    但是发布到WINDOWS 2003下运行就不行,

    报错

     说明: 执行当前 Web 请求期间,出现未处理的异常。请检查堆栈跟踪信息,以了解有关该错误以及代码中导致错误的出处的详细信息。

    异常详细信息: System.ArgumentNullException: 值不能为空。
    参数名: type

    源错误:

    执行当前 Web 请求期间生成了未处理的异常。可以使用下面的异常堆栈跟踪信息确定有关异常原因和发生位置的信息。

    堆栈跟踪:

    [ArgumentNullException: 值不能为空。
    参数名: type]
      System.Activator.CreateInstance(Type type, Boolean nonPublic) +2796659
      System.Web.Profile.ProfileBase.CreateMyInstance(String username, Boolean isAuthenticated) +76
      System.Web.Profile.ProfileBase.Create(String username, Boolean isAuthenticated) +312
      System.Web.HttpContext.get_Profile() +89
      MasterPage_AdminMasterPage.get_Profile() +14
      MasterPage_AdminMasterPage.bindMenu() +13
      MasterPage_AdminMasterPage.Page_Load(Object sender, EventArgs e) +196
      System.Web.Util.CalliHelper.EventArgFunctionCaller(IntPtr fp, Object o, Object t, EventArgs e) +15
      System.Web.Util.CalliEventHandlerDelegateProxy.Callback(Object sender, EventArgs e) +34
      System.Web.UI.Control.OnLoad(EventArgs e) +99
      System.Web.UI.Control.LoadRecursive() +47
      System.Web.UI.Control.LoadRecursive() +131
      System.Web.UI.Page.ProcessRequestMain(Boolean includeStagesBeforeAsyncPoint, Boolean includeStagesAfterAsyncPoint) +1061
    


    版本信息: Microsoft .NET Framework 版本:2.0.50727.42; ASP.NET 版本:2.0.50727.210

     

    请高手们知道,谢谢!

     

     

     


    msdn
    2010年5月27日 6:57

答案

全部回复